Finger cross, what does this mean?

It means to hope that something will take place, that your desire or wish will be fulfilled.
example
How did you do in the exam?
I think I passed, well fingers crossed.

You say "fingers crossed" when you hope or wish for something.
For example: "I think I'm pregnant! Fingers crossed."
If you want to, you can actually cross your index fingers and middle fingers when you say it. According to old Christian beliefs, it brings good luck and wards off evil spirits or witches.

Fingers crossed accompanied by the same action means that that person hopes that things will turn out the way he/she wants them to.
Example:
Q.Do you think that you'll win the lottery?
A. Fingers crossed!
